`
cuichang
  • 浏览: 92679 次
  • 性别: Icon_minigender_1
  • 来自: 北京
文章分类
社区版块
存档分类
最新评论

iphone 开发记事本

阅读更多

1. 外部资源 添加到 Resources 目录 中 。

2.

#import <UIKit/UIKit.h>

 

@interface Control_FunViewController : UIViewController {

UITextField *nameField;

UITextField *numberField;

 

}

@property (nonatomic,retain) IBOutlet UITextField *nameField;

@property (nonatomic,retain) IBOutlet UITextField *numberField;

 

@end

 

IBOutlet 表示输出口,IBOutlet可以放在声明时,但新版本建议放到属性声明时。

 

其中 nameField 为输出口。

retain 表示 编译器向分配给此属性的对象发一个保留消息。这将保证属性底层的实例变量在使用过程中不会从内存中清除,这个是必须声明的。  如果变量是对象则需要指定此属性,如果是int类的则不需要。

 

nonatomic 可选属性,如果没有将改变访问方法和修改方法的生成方式,用于帮助编写多线程程序。声明之后可以节省开销, 大多数情况下,iphone应用程序都指定nonatomic属性。

 

3.

 

#import "Control_FunViewController.h"

 

@implementation Control_FunViewController

@synthesize nameField;

@synthesize numberField;


@synthesize  其作用是通知编译器 为我们自动创建 访问方法和修改方法。添加此行代码之后,我们的类中会存在两个不可见的方法,numeField和setNameField;   我们并没有编写这两个方法,他们是自动创建的,我们只需使用就可以了。

 

4.

 控件属性:

opaque :  如果选择 ,则此视图后的任何内容都不应绘制。

 

clip subviews: 如果你的视图有子视图,并且这些子视图并不是完全包含在父视图中,则此复选框将确定子视图的绘制方式,如果选中了Clip Subviews,只有在父视图范围内的子视图被绘制出来。如果未选中Clip Subviews 则全部子视图 都将绘制出来,而不管它是否在父视图内部。

 

 

5. object 语言 注释:   //    /*   */   和java  类似。 

 

 

6.控件都四种状态:

   1普通

   2突出显示

   3禁用

   4选中

7.连接的问题:

 从File's Owner 连接到控件,实际是把在Controller声明的 输出口 连接到界面中的控件,在程序中操作 输出口就是操作界面的控件了。

从控件到File's Owner ,实际是把控件的事件和Controller中的方法联系起来,控件的事件产生后,进入到Controller的方法中。

分享到:
评论

相关推荐

    Iphone开发系列源码——Iphone主题源码

    Iphone开发系列源码——Iphone主题源码Iphone开发系列源码——Iphone主题源码Iphone开发系列源码——Iphone主题源码Iphone开发系列源码——Iphone主题源码Iphone开发系列源码——Iphone主题源码Iphone开发系列源码...

    iPhone开发实战.pdf

    iPhone开发实战 iPhone开发 iPhone iPhone4 iPhone开发实战 iPhone开发 iPhone iPhone4

    Iphone开发系列源码——iPhone版Wordpress源代码

    Iphone开发系列源码——iPhone版Wordpress源代码Iphone开发系列源码——iPhone版Wordpress源代码Iphone开发系列源码——iPhone版Wordpress源代码Iphone开发系列源码——iPhone版Wordpress源代码Iphone开发系列源码...

    Iphone风格语音记事本

    Iphone风格的语音记事本 录音机 代码是通过修改android自带的录音机recording的源码得到的,仅供学习参考

    Iphone开发系列源码——Image图片缩放随着手指

    Iphone开发系列源码——Image图片缩放随着手指Iphone开发系列源码——Image图片缩放随着手指Iphone开发系列源码——Image图片缩放随着手指Iphone开发系列源码——Image图片缩放随着手指Iphone开发系列源码——Image...

    iPhone开发基础教程电子书

    这里推荐两本书《objective-c基础教程》和《iphone开发基础教程》,这两本都是圣经级的巨作,我相信每一个iphone开发人员应该都不会错过这两本书的。  等你xcode和objective-c摸熟之后,或者说,上面提到的那两...

    iPhone开发基础教程

    《iPhone开发基础教程》内容完整丰富,具有较强的通用性,编程领域中各层次读者都能通过《iPhone开发基础教程》快速学习iPhone开发,提高相关技能。iPhone 是一种全新的移动平台,苹果公司为它推出了强大的软件开发...

    iPhone开发基础教程-PDF版

    iPhone开发,iPhone开发教程,iPhone开发基础教程PDF版

    Iphone开发系列源码——多功能播放器源码

    Iphone开发系列源码——多功能播放器源码Iphone开发系列源码——多功能播放器源码Iphone开发系列源码——多功能播放器源码Iphone开发系列源码——多功能播放器源码Iphone开发系列源码——多功能播放器源码Iphone开发...

    Iphone开发系列源码——星级评价实现代码

    Iphone开发系列源码——星级评价实现代码Iphone开发系列源码——星级评价实现代码Iphone开发系列源码——星级评价实现代码Iphone开发系列源码——星级评价实现代码Iphone开发系列源码——星级评价实现代码Iphone开发...

    深入浅出iPhone开发(清晰版,内含中英2个版本的书)

    知名的Head First系列丛书之一,风格与其他Head First系列一脉相承,一定能让读者轻松学会iPhone开发,《深入浅出iPhone开发》是针对iPhone开发的初学者设计的,以几个应用实例的开发为例,循序渐进地对iPhone开发的...

    iPhone开发入门到精通视频教程

    资源名称:iPhone开发入门到精通视频教程资源目录:【】iOS开发源码系列---工具【】iOS开发源码系列---应用【】iOS开发源码系列---游戏【】iOS开发源码系列---类库与框架【】iOS开发真机测试与发布【】iOS开发视频...

    Iphone开发系列源码——长按实现图标抖动和删除的代码

    Iphone开发系列源码——长按实现图标抖动和删除的代码Iphone开发系列源码——长按实现图标抖动和删除的代码Iphone开发系列源码——长按实现图标抖动和删除的代码Iphone开发系列源码——长按实现图标抖动和删除的代码...

    iphone开发视频教程

    资源名称:iphone开发视频教程资源目录:【】iphone开发视频教程第1集 Mac.OS.X,Cocoa,Touch,Objective-C【】iphone开发视频教程第2集 各种基础的类,功能,对象和实例的介绍【】iphone开发视频教程第3集 如何创建你...

    Iphone开发系列源码——图表和报表的统计功能

    Iphone开发系列源码——图表和报表的统计功能Iphone开发系列源码——图表和报表的统计功能Iphone开发系列源码——图表和报表的统计功能Iphone开发系列源码——图表和报表的统计功能Iphone开发系列源码——图表和报表...

    Iphone开发系列源码——公交线路查询项目完整源码

    Iphone开发系列源码——公交线路查询项目完整源码Iphone开发系列源码——公交线路查询项目完整源码Iphone开发系列源码——公交线路查询项目完整源码Iphone开发系列源码——公交线路查询项目完整源码Iphone开发系列...

    轻松学iPhone开发

    轻松学iPhone共分3篇。第1篇介绍iPhone的发展、iPhone开发环境以及开发工具的安装过程、iPhone Simulator模拟器

    让不懂编程的人爱上iPhone开发2

    让不懂编程的人爱上iPhone开发002.pdf

    iphone开发实战

    本书全面探讨了iPhone平台的两种编程方式——Web开发和SDK编程。全在Web开发方面,分别介绍了三个iPhone Web库,即WebKit、iUI和Canvas,并讨论了Web开发环境Dashcode,最后阐述... 本书适合所有iPhone开发人员学习参考

    深入浅出iPhone开发

    《深入浅出iPhone开发》,本书是针对iPhone开发的初学者设计的,以几个应用实例的开发为例,循序渐进地对iPhone开发的各个方面进行了讲解。

Global site tag (gtag.js) - Google Analytics